Daedalic Entertainment delay The Lord of the Rings: Gollum to 2022

The Lord of the Rings: Gollum is an upcoming action-adventure game developed by Daedalic Entertainment and published by Nacon. During the period between the ring’s loss and the Lord of the Rings Trilogy, the game will take place in Middle Earth.

LOTR: Gollum started development back in 2019, with an initial release date of somewhere in 2021. However, Daedalic Entertainment has announced that they’ll be pushing back their estimated release window to 2022 to give players a better experience of playing the game.

LOTR: Gollum will feature stealth and action-based gameplay, while in the meantime, you’ll need to control your inner self. You’ll get special dialogues if you want to stick with your human-self Smeagol or turn to the greediness of Gollum.

The game will be released for Xbox One Xbox Series X/S, PS5, PS4, and PC sometime in 2022. We hope this Middle-Earth game will do as well as those in recent years like Shadow of War and Shadow of Mordor.
